Hadith.2095 - It is narrated by Al-Hasan ibn Mahbub, from Abu Ayyub, from Abu Basir, from Abu Abdullah (as), who said: "I'tikaf cannot be for less than three days. Whoever performs i'tikaf must fast, and it is appropriate for the one performing i'tikaf to make a stipulation, just as one who enters into ihram (for pilgrimage) makes a stipulation."
